DTC 24: Water Temperature Signal

  1. Remove instrument cluster. See INSTRUMENT CLUSTER  under REMOVAL & INSTALLATION. Disconnect water temperature sensor connector. Select DTC 24. If LCD indicates 252-255, go to next step. If LCD indicates other than 252-255, replace instrument cluster.
  2. Using a jumper wire, connect instrument cluster connector No. 3, terminal 3E to ground. See Figure . If LCD indicates 000-003, go to next step. If LCD indicates other than 000-003, replace instrument cluster. See INSTRUMENT CLUSTER  under REMOVAL & INSTALLATION.
  3. Connect SST (fuel and thermometer checker) or 20-ohm resistor between instrument cluster connector No. 3, terminal 3E and ground. See Figure . If LCD indicates 018-036, go to next step. If LCD indicates other than 018-036, replace instrument cluster. See INSTRUMENT CLUSTER  under REMOVAL & INSTALLATION.
  4. Connect SST (fuel and thermometer checker) or 60-ohm resistor between instrument cluster connector No. 3, terminal 3E and ground. See Figure . If LCD indicates 048-085, go to next step. If LCD indicates other than 048-085, replace instrument cluster. See INSTRUMENT CLUSTER  under REMOVAL & INSTALLATION.
  5. Connect SST (fuel and thermometer checker) or 100-ohm resistor between instrument cluster connector No. 3, terminal 3E and ground. See Figure . If LCD indicates 070-121, check temperature gauge sending unit. See TEMPERATURE GAUGE SENDING UNIT  under COMPONENT TESTS. If LCD indicates other than 070-121, replace instrument cluster. See INSTRUMENT CLUSTER  under REMOVAL & INSTALLATION.
